On August 3, 2026, INAES Res. No. 1567/26 was published in Argentina's Official Gazette. The Resolution approves a new AML/CTF/CPF Compliance System designed to streamline, modernize, and centralize the reporting framework applicable to cooperatives and mutual associations subject to UIF Resolution No. 99/23.


? What does this new Resolution establish?


?? Approves a new AML/CTF/CPF Compliance System, centralizing all information and supporting documentation required by INAES.


?? Consolidates multiple reporting regimes into a single digital platform, eliminating duplicate filings and significantly reducing administrative burdens.


?? Requires Reporting Entities to file sworn statements containing, among other information: a.) Registration as a Reporting Entity before the FIU; b.) Appointment of the Compliance Officers; c.) Approved AML/CTF/CPF Manual; d.) Annual aggregate amount of loans granted; e.) Identification of directors, legal representatives, managers, and attorneys-in-fact; f.) Information regarding the twenty principal members (cooperatives only).


?? Requires members of the governing and supervisory bodies to electronically file their Politically Exposed Person (PEP) Declarations.


?? Requires annual updates, as well as immediate updates whenever any material change occurs.


?? Repeals INAES Res. 5588/12 and 1863/19, replacing the previous reporting framework with a single, fully digital compliance system.


? When does it become effective?


? Thirty (30) calendar days after its publication in the Official Gazette.


? Initial filings must be submitted within 90 days following the Resolution's effective date.


? Main Objective?


? Align the INAES supervisory framework with FIU Res. 99/23.


? Further strengthen the implementation of the Risk-Based Approach.


? Consolidate AML/CTF/CPF information within a single integrated digital platform.


? Reduce administrative burdens through automation and data migration.


? Strengthen the supervision of cooperatives and mutual associations in accordance with international standards and the recommendations arising from FATF's latest Mutual Evaluation of Argentina.
